Starlight is a detached cottage in Talog, Carmarthenshire. It's on about fifteen acres of our land, so the views are just fields and woods. There's a stream at the bottom.
It sleeps six, in three bedrooms. Two are upstairs with super king beds, one is on the ground floor with a king. There are two bathrooms, one is a wet room downstairs. It's been done up recently so everything's modern and in good order. It has a 5 Star rating.
The main room is open plan. The kitchen has what you'd need, including a dishwasher. There's a private deck outside with a hot tub. We can set up a firepit if you ask beforehand. The area has dark skies, so you can see the stars well if it's clear.
The site has wheelchair-friendly paths around the cottage and to the hot tub.
Carmarthen is about twenty minutes away for supermarkets and shops. The coast, like Tenby or Saundersfoot, is under half an hour by car. There are plenty of beaches there.
For local walks, the National Trust and Visit Wales sites have good information. The National Botanic Garden is nearby and worth a visit. You're also on the route for National Cycle Route 47 if you're bringing bikes.
Facilities include parking, an electric vehicle charger, WiFi, a washing machine, and a cot and highchair if needed. Bedding and towels are included. You can bring up to two dogs.
